Below are the details of the Vessel, weather condition, damage incurred and other accident details such as the date: On 03 November 2004, the tug "VICTORY V" with log tow, reported the log tow struck the Gallows Point Spar Buoy ULP4, dragging the Navigational Aid away from its position, near Protection Island, B.C.
